If there's anything San Antonio loves, it's free things. So, mark your calendars, y'all. The city's parks and recreation department will be giving away more than 1,200 free trees from 10 a.m. to 1 p.m. on Saturday, November 8, at the Mission Marquee Plaza, according to a news release from the department.
Dashi Sichuan Kitchen + Bar has officially closed after a four-year run on San Antonio's Northside. Founder and chef Kristina Zhao opened the restaurant with her team in 2021, focusing on a more contemporary dining experience than Dashi's sister restaurant, Sichuan House.

A report examining the June flooding that killed 13 people in San Antonio was released to the city council on Thursday. It highlights the velocity of floodwaters reaching eight feet per second and more than two feet high in some places.
